Understanding Tool Steel
Tool steel is a specific grade of steel designed primarily for making tools. It possesses distinct properties that make it ideal for manufacturing applications due to its hardness, wear resistance, and ability to maintain a cutting edge under high temperatures. The various classifications of tool steel include:
- Cold Work Tool Steel
- Hot Work Tool Steel
- High-Speed Tool Steel
- Mold Steel
Key Characteristics of High-Quality Tool Steel Plates
High-quality tool steel plates feature several notable characteristics:
- Durability: Resistant to wear and deformation, ideal for high-volume production.
- Heat Resistance: Maintains its hardness at high temperatures, making it suitable for automotive and aerospace applications.
- Machinability: Can be easily machined into complex shapes without losing integrity.
- Surface Finish: High-quality surface finish allows for better tooling outcomes.

Factors to Consider When Choosing Tool Steel Plates
When selecting tool steel plates for precision manufacturing, consider the following factors to ensure maximum efficiency and performance:
- Type of Steel: Choose between cold work, hot work, high-speed, or mold steel based on application needs.
- Hardness: Evaluate the Rockwell hardness rating, which affects wear resistance and durability.
- Treatment Processes: Consider the heat treatment processes used, as they significantly affect the steel's properties.
- Supplier Reputation: Opt for reputable suppliers who can guarantee the quality of their tool steel.
- Cost: While quality is paramount, keeping an eye on cost-effectiveness is also crucial.
